Webb13 mars 1995 · The Rams had demanded that St. Louis sell 40,000 PSLs before they would move. By last Thursday, Fans Inc. had orders for 74,000 PSLs. That huge total shattered skeptics' claims that St. Louis isn't a football town; in fact, it represented 11,000 more fans than the new stadium will be able to accommodate. WebbThen-owner Georgia Frontiere moved the Rams from Los Angeles in 1995 to her hometown of St. Louis, where they stayed for 21 seasons before Kroenke moved them back. Kroenke, a Missouri real estate developer who is married to an heir of the Walmart fortune, became a minority owner when the team first came to St. Louis.
